The Foundation of Communication

Clear communication forms the cornerstone of any successful mechanic-customer relationship. When you bring your vehicle in for service, a trustworthy mechanic takes time to listen carefully to your concerns. They ask specific questions about when problems occur, what sounds you're hearing, or how the vehicle is performing differently than usual. This dialogue isn't just polite conversation—it's essential for diagnostic accuracy.

Once the initial assessment is complete, quality auto repair services provide detailed explanations in language you can understand. A good mechanic doesn't hide behind technical jargon or make you feel inadequate for asking questions. Instead, they walk you through what they've discovered, explain why certain repairs are necessary, and outline what might happen if issues go unaddressed. This transparency empowers you to make informed decisions about your vehicle's care.

Communication continues throughout the repair process. If additional problems surface during work or if timelines change, you receive prompt notification. This ongoing dialogue eliminates the anxiety of wondering what's happening with your vehicle and demonstrates respect for your time and investment.

The Power of Honest Pricing

Nothing erodes trust faster than unexpected costs or unclear billing. Honest pricing means providing detailed, written estimates before any work begins. These estimates should break down parts and labor costs separately, explaining what each line item represents. When you understand exactly what you're paying for, you can evaluate whether the proposed work aligns with your budget and priorities.

Transparent pricing also means explaining when you have options. Perhaps there's a choice between original equipment manufacturer parts and quality aftermarket alternatives. Maybe a repair can be staged over time rather than completed all at once. Mechanics who prioritize customer satisfaction present these options clearly, explaining the trade-offs without pressuring you toward the more expensive choice.

Quality shops also stand behind their work with warranties that protect your investment. Whether it's a 30-day guarantee on specific repairs or longer coverage on major components, these assurances demonstrate confidence in workmanship and commitment to your satisfaction.

What to Look for in a Trusted Mechanic

As you search for dependable auto repair services, several indicators can help identify shops worthy of your trust. Look for certifications that demonstrate ongoing training and expertise. Ask how they handle diagnostic accuracy—do they invest in modern equipment and continued education? Inquire about their approach to estimates and whether they contact you before performing any work beyond the initial scope.

Pay attention to how staff treats you during initial interactions. Do they listen attentively? Answer questions patiently? Provide clear timelines? These early impressions often predict the quality of service you'll receive throughout your relationship.

Don't hesitate to ask for references or read online reviews, but remember that one-off negative experiences happen at even excellent shops. Look for patterns in feedback regarding communication, pricing transparency, and overall customer satisfaction.
